D-Syrup is an original distributed SAT solver based on the portfolio paradigm. This solver, dedicated to work on plenty of cores, implements a new fully hybrid distributed programming model from Syrup. This page contains the version of D-Syrup proposed in the paper "A Distributed Version of Syrup" accepted to the 20th International Conference on Theory and Applications of Satisfiability Testing (SAT'17).  [PDF]
